Howdy guys, needing some help with an isuzu problem.

Im looking at buying an isuzu for cheap, only problem is that its throwing oil out the breather,

Anyone know what this could be?

is it a simple fix? new head has been put on, new turbo and a couple of other little things here and there.

this is also the second engine, done around 120,000 ks

its a factory 30mm lift and bullbar model if that helps.

put a catch can on it, and just empty it back in the motor when its full or tap into the dipstick tube and have the oil return back in to the engine, easy as

Mine did that, thet are a prone to presurizing the sump its just an Isuzu thing. As Gotflex said chuck a ctach can on and the problem will be solved, just make sure its not a cheap one, it needs to have some fine mesh in it to seperate the oil from the air otherwise it will just keep on going and not get caught

Remove all the EGR (Exhaust Gas Recycle) emission stuff off as this will blow the head gasket/or crack the head and as above comment do not let it get hot.

Ok guys looks like something else has popped up.

I have been keeping and eye on the pressure temp etc, and all is fine,

apart from the fact i can almost use the oil pressure guage as a rev counter.

the breather has also started making a funny turbo whistling sound, which leads me to the conclusion that the a seal has gone in the turbo, which is forcing air into the oil galleries, which in turn is forcing both air and oil out the breather, causing the problem.

im also going to get a compression test done, just to make sure.
